The Role
Lead and grow Scania truck sales by achieving targets, managing offers/contracts and tenders, setting budgets and KPIs, coaching the sales team, analyzing market and competitors, collaborating with other departments, ensuring compliance, and overseeing LG/LC financial processes.

Sales Growth and Market Share

Maintain and increase Scania’s truck market share by achieving set sales targets and implementing effective sales strategies.

Sales Contract Management

Oversee and sign all offers, sales contracts, and superstructure contracts to ensure alignment with company policies and customer satisfaction.

Tender Management

Lead and manage the tender process, from submission to finalization, ensuring competitive pricing and adherence to regulations.

Budgeting and Financial Targets

Set and negotiate the annual sales budget, ensuring the department meets its financial targets and contributes to overall profitability.

Market and Competitor Analysis

Monitor and analyze market trends, customer needs, and competitor activities, adjusting sales strategies accordingly to stay competitive.

Team Leadership and Development

Coach and develop the sales team, ensuring continuous improvement in skills and competencies, and conduct regular performance evaluations.

Setting KPIs and Monitoring Performance

Establish KPIs for the sales team and regularly follow up to ensure they are on track to meet sales objectives.

Sales Strategy Development

Develop and implement sales strategies that align with Scania’s goals, ensuring collaboration across departments for holistic business success.

Cross-Department Collaboration

Foster cooperation with other departments, including finance, marketing, and aftersales, to enhance the overall customer experience and business efficiency.

Issue Resolution and Lessons Learned

Identify challenges at the deal level, resolve issues, and share lessons learned to improve processes and customer satisfaction.

Compliance and Policy Adherence

Ensure that all activities comply with company policies, procedures, and legal requirements.

Team Culture and Values

Promote a team-based and cooperative atmosphere aligned with Scania’s values, ensuring a positive and collaborative work environment.

Financial Process Monitoring

Follow up on Letter of Guarantee (LG) and Letter of Credit (LC) processes to ensure timely and accurate execution.
